results so far

Wildcard Round

Zhang Dongtao (CHN) W/O Li Yinxi (CHN)

Zhou Yuelong (CHN) 4-0 Zheng Peng (CHN)

Chen Zifan (CHN) 4-2 Luo Guangsheng (CHN)

Zhang Yang (CHN) 4-1 Mu Gang (CHN)

Zhu Yingui (CHN) 4-0 Lian Tenghao (HKG)

Lu Ning (CHN) 4-3 Chen Bo (CHN)

Lin Shuai (CHN) 4-0 Yin Lun-Cheng (HKG)

A Bulajiang (CHN) 4-0 Chan Ka Kin (HKG)

Shi Hanging (CHN) 4-1 Zhang Yadong (CHN)

Zhao Xintong (CHN) 4-1 Fang Yuantun (MAL)

Fung Kwok-Wai (HKG) 4-1 Zhang Yong (CHN)

Yang Qiantian (CHN) 4-3 Sun Chang (CHN)

Wang Yuchen (CHN) W/O Wang Chulho (KOR)

It's time to introduce this place:

In former China Professional Tour, Jiang Jiagang has held three years(From 2009 to 2011).
The chanpions were Ding Junhui(2009), Rouzi Maimaiti(2010) and Yu Delu(2011).
Because Jiang Jiagang Championship was one of the largest national snooker event in China, therefore APTC 1 is not the problem for the organizer; also, the calculation of national ranking will be changed.

P.S.:
●Rouzi Maimaiti was the first champion that qualified from division qualifying stage.
●After the victory of first title, Yu Delu got the wildcard to the Pro Tour.
